Our recent paper on is open to the public in (doi.org/10.36227/techrxiv.1740). In it, we propose a system that manages network services accurately and efficiently, and provide theoretical and experimental proofs that demonstrate such qualities. The proposed system is enabled by the integration of information-centric networking, telemetry compression, distributed processing, autonomic decision services, and fault detection services.
